Casa de Sante Advanced Probiotics GI Support is formulated for digestion that doesn't work the way it should, whether that's medication-induced or just how your gut is wired. Each capsule provides 5.75 billion CFU of a targeted multi-strain blend, including Lactobacillus and Bifidobacterium strains to support a balanced gut microbiome, plus DE111® (Bacillus subtilis), a spore-forming strain selected for stability through heat and stomach acid.
It's also designed without common high-FODMAP fillers like inulin, chicory root fiber, fructooligosaccharides, and lactose-based carriers, so sensitive stomachs are less likely to react.

What this product cannot do
Advanced Probiotics GI Support is a dietary supplement, not a medicine. It does not treat, cure or prevent IBS, SIBO, or any disease, it does not replace a low-FODMAP elimination diet or prescribed therapy, and it will not stop symptoms caused by an untreated medical condition. If you have new, severe, or changing GI symptoms, or you are pregnant, nursing, or on prescription medication (including GLP-1 medication), speak to your clinician first.
